Algebra 1 Concepts Explained: A Simplified Approach
Algebra 1 forms the foundation of many higher-level mathematical concepts. It introduces students to fundamental ideas such as variables, equations, inequalities, and functions. Understanding these concepts is crucial for success in future mathematics courses and related fields. Edmentum Answers can be helpful in breaking down complex problems into smaller, manageable steps. For instance, solving a multi-step equation can often seem daunting. By using the answers to check the process step-by-step, students can pinpoint where they made mistakes and learn the correct approach.
Let's consider a simple example: solving the equation 2x + 5 = 9. A student might initially struggle with isolating the variable 'x'. Edmentum Answers would provide the solution, showing the steps involved: subtracting 5 from both sides (2x = 4), and then dividing both sides by 2 (x = 2). By analyzing this step-by-step solution, the student can understand the underlying logic and apply it to similar problems. However, simply copying the solution without understanding the reasoning offers no genuine learning benefit.

Effective Use of Edmentum Answers: A Balanced Learning Strategy
The key to successfully leveraging Edmentum Answers lies in a balanced approach. It's not about avoiding the answers entirely; rather, it's about using them strategically and thoughtfully. A recommended approach is to attempt the problem independently first. If a student gets stuck, they can consult a portion of the solution, perhaps one step at a time, to guide their thinking and identify the point of difficulty. This process fosters active learning and problem-solving skills, as opposed to passively copying answers. Students should actively try to understand the 'why' behind each step, rather than just memorizing the procedure.
Furthermore, Edmentum’s platform often includes helpful hints and explanations within the answer section. These hints can be invaluable in guiding the student toward the correct solution method. It is crucial that students engage actively with these hints, trying to understand the underlying principles and not just use them to obtain the final answer. Potential Pitfalls and Alternative Learning Approaches
Over-reliance on Edmentum Answers can lead to several negative consequences. Firstly, it can hinder the development of crucial problem-solving skills. Constantly relying on ready-made solutions prevents students from developing their own problem-solving strategies and critical thinking abilities. This can be particularly detrimental in future mathematics courses where independent problem-solving is crucial. Secondly, it can create a false sense of understanding. Students might believe they understand the material because they can get the correct answer, but this understanding might be superficial and lack depth.
To mitigate these risks, students should adopt alternative learning approaches. This includes actively participating in class, asking questions, and seeking help from teachers or tutors when needed. Utilizing additional learning resources, such as practice problems from textbooks or online sources, is also beneficial. Collaboration with peers can foster a deeper understanding of concepts and provide diverse perspectives. Finally, focusing on understanding the underlying concepts rather than simply memorizing procedures is vital for long-term success in algebra and beyond. Learning to break down complex problems into smaller, manageable steps, and to identify patterns and relationships, are key to mastering algebra. Edmentum Answers can be a part of this process, but only as a supplementary tool, not as a replacement for active learning and critical thinking.
